Cristian Marez is the 2nd ranked Men’s Street Luge Athlete qualified to race in the upcoming 2024 World Skate Games in Italy.
We had a chance to ask Cris a few questions about his experience as an up and coming athlete. Here’s a peek at the interview:
Let’s kick it back to the beginning. What sparked your passion for street luge, and how did you get started in the sport?
“I started DH skating after a friend saw me cruising on campus and invited me to a session and I eventually was curious about street luges so started trying to make them. Been having fun making and riding them ever since.”
Every athlete has a unique journey. What’s been the key to your success and progression in street luge?
“My location has been a huge factor in my ongoing journey, given I have access to the San Diego and LA scene which are both amazing. I’ve made so many good friends and memories along the way.”
